Obviously, before I started stamping, I used to quilt. When I saw this week’s challenge, I immediately thought of making a paper quilt. I used the new ODBD Christmas paper and selected some coordinating papers (much like a quilter does), cut 1.5-inch squares, and started piecing my “quilt.” After arranging the colors, I put a little bit of tape in the center of each square and flipped them over in order. I used the solid card stock for my “binding” (and drew a pencil line to begin aligning the pieces), and arranged them on the paper. I stitched them on my sewing machine (which really misses me…LOL!). For the focal image, I used the poinsettia (and matching die) from the new set Poinsettia Wreath. It was fun to make, and a quilt reminds me of how God takes the bits and pieces of our lives and makes something beautiful! And since this doesn’t have a sentiment, I decided to add a warm Christmas sentiment “underneath” it inside (much like a quilt warms you when you get under it).
